Hope Street Actor Finnian Garbutt Announces He Is in Final Stages of Life After Cancer Diagnosis
Finnian Garbutt, the 28-year-old star of BBC One Northern Ireland's popular series Hope Street, has revealed that he is entering the 'last stages of his life' following a four-year battle with cancer. The actor, who portrays police constable Ryan Power, shared the heartbreaking update on social media on Sunday, March 1, 2026, stating that recent scans showed the disease has progressed rapidly throughout his body.
Diagnosis and Treatment Journey
Garbutt's cancer journey began in 2020 when he discovered a lump behind his ear at the age of 25. After lockdown restrictions eased, his barber noticed the lump had grown significantly, leading to a diagnosis of Stage 3 skin cancer. In February 2022, he underwent a grueling 12-hour surgery to remove 75 lymph nodes from his neck and face. Despite this aggressive treatment, the cancer advanced to Stage IV melanoma in August 2024, just two weeks before the birth of his daughter.
In his Instagram post, Garbutt explained that he had been experiencing pain in his back and hip over the past month, prompting his medical team to admit him for observations and scans. The results confirmed the rapid progression of the cancer, marking a devastating turn in his health.
Personal Reflections and Achievements
Despite the grim prognosis, Garbutt expressed gratitude for the milestones he has achieved since his diagnosis. He highlighted accomplishments such as starring in 30 episodes of Hope Street, landing a lead role in an upcoming film titled Housejackers, purchasing his own home, marrying his best friend, and becoming a father to a baby girl who brings him constant joy. He emphasized his desire to focus on spending quality time with his family and friends, noting that sharing the news publicly was a way to avoid the emotional difficulty of telling people individually.
Garbutt also extended an invitation to fans and well-wishers, encouraging them to reach out for a pint, coffee, or casual conversation, showcasing his resilient and positive spirit amidst the challenges.
Impact on Hope Street and Career
Finnian Garbutt joined the cast of Hope Street in 2023, quickly becoming a fan favorite as the young and dynamic police constable Ryan Power. His character has been central to numerous dramatic storylines, particularly in the last two seasons with the introduction of love interest Brandi McClure. As one of the longest-serving cast members following series changes, Garbutt has delivered powerful performances that have resonated deeply with audiences.
Prior to Hope Street, Garbutt appeared in an episode of Casualty in 2020 and is set to star in the film Housejackers, demonstrating his versatility and dedication to his craft.
